    Biamory refers to someone who is non-monogamous and is only capable of feeling attraction towards or being in a relationship with exactly two individuals at a time.[1] These two individuals could be of any gender, depending on the individual's sexuality and romantic orientation.

    One who is biamorous may also identify as duogamous, however this is not always the case.

    History

    The coiner of the term is unknown, however it has been used amongst the community since 2016.

    Flag

    The flag was coined by pride-color-schemes on tumblr. Its colors are a mix of the bisexual and polyamorous flag colors.
